Sitrans LR560 radar level instrument for solid materials

Wednesday, 03 August, 2011 | Supplied by: Siemens Ltd


The Sitrans LR560 is a radar level instrument for solid materials levels in bins and silos to a depth of 100 m. It is a 2-wire plug-and-play, 78 GHz FMCW radar level transmitter for continuous monitoring of solids, with materials with εr>2.

The major advantage of a radar device using 78 GHz frequency is its ability to deliver a narrow beam of only 4°. A tight beam angle reduces the need for aiming and also means it can be installed in places previously inaccessible to other radar devices.

The lens antenna has an effective diameter of up to 60 mm at a frequency of 78 GHz. This shorter wavelength results in less deflection from the solid pile in a storage facility - especially useful when measuring materials like grain, cement and small pellets.

A radar device operating at 24 GHz would require a large horn diameter of 195 mm to achieve the same gain.

A graphical quick start wizard enables users to commission the device easily and the unit has its own touch pad for programming. It can also be programmed remotely using the Siemens Hand Programmer.
